Output e51ac3dab3928ee25224eceb492dede23dc86370da2cf355528d183610dec8db:0

value
904861
script pubkey
OP_0 OP_PUSHBYTES_20 100caa5f6844260fc7779ccf05559adb5748b5e3
address
bc1qzqx25hmggsnql3mhnn8s24v6mdt53d0rqmnh2n
transaction
e51ac3dab3928ee25224eceb492dede23dc86370da2cf355528d183610dec8db
confirmations
166744
spent
true